Latest Patents
Atkinson holds a patent for a cordless telephone system. This system features a control unit equipped with a speaker, a microphone, and control circuitry. It operates in various modes, including 'normal' for communications with outside parties, 'local answer' for interactions between the control unit and outside parties, 'intercom' for communications between the control unit and the handset, and '3-way' for simultaneous communication with outside parties. The system utilizes a microprocessor to respond to ring detect, control, and switch-generated interrupt signals, ensuring seamless communication.
